How far people went at school, the qualifications they hold and what they studied.
Nearly 30% of qualified adults in Maroochy hold a Certificate III or IV, marking the most common qualification in the area. The region has seen a strong push toward higher learning, with the share of people holding bachelor degrees rising by 8.4 percentage points since 2011. Maroochy now sits slightly above the Queensland average for university qualifications.
Highest year of school completed.
Year 12 completion rates rose 9.1 percentage points since 2011 to reach 56.8%. This figure is about the same as the Queensland average and just a little below the national figure.

In Maroochy, Year 12 is the majority at 62%; Year 10 is next at 23%.
Post-school qualifications and degrees.
About 22.9% of adults have a bachelor degree or higher, which is higher than most similar areas. While this is a little above the Queensland average, it remains well below the Australian figure of 26.3%.

In Maroochy, the largest group is Certificate III / IV at 36%, followed by Bachelor degree (29%) and Advanced diploma / diploma (20%).
What people studied.
Management and commerce are the most common fields of study at 17.8%, followed by health and engineering, which both sit at 12.0%.
Schools in the area and how many children they serve (ACARA).
Maroochy has just 9 schools, among the smallest number for an area of this level. These schools are much larger than most, with an average size of 759 students, and they generally have a higher advantage score than most areas.
